Output 76f58b60ec4c37e31ff782f424735dce6741fd1100daae51b7f6de799f3c8796:62

value
3905334
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41848ca46ee121841aff9891192ddf56e9481a4a OP_EQUALVERIFY OP_CHECKSIG
address
16yRiANkV6rBpYohjeCQNKyWSYJdwAthvb
transaction
76f58b60ec4c37e31ff782f424735dce6741fd1100daae51b7f6de799f3c8796
spent
true